This research project aims to investigate the impact of artificial intelligence (AI) on job automation and workforce transformation. With the rapid advancements in AI technology, there is growing concern about the potential displacement of human workers by automation. This study will examine the industries and job roles most susceptible to automation, analyze the potential benefits and challenges of AI adoption in the workforce, and explore strategies for managing the transition to an AI-driven economy. The findings of this research will provide valuable insights for policymakers, businesses, and individuals in navigating the changing landscape of work.
